Egret入门

1、搭建开发环境

  1、Egret产品引擎下载地址:http://www.egret.com/egretengine

  2、Egret Wing:强大的IDE工具

    Wing主要功能特点:   

1
2
3
4
5
6
7
8
9
1. 数倍的工作效率提升。Egret Wing从UI项目制作、皮肤定制、布局适配、交互设计、代码编辑,到代码调试等环节都更加完善。
 
2. 全局可视化操作流程,为美术策划、UI设计和程序开发人员带来高效的工作体验。
 
3. 更加便捷的UI动画效果编辑。动画面板,以时间轴的方式操作UI组件,配合属性面板操作UI动画的不同属性,制作出炫酷的动画效果,并支持实时预览动画效果。
 
4. 丰富的智能代码提示和编辑的开发环境。针对Egret项目开发的工具环境,提供更加智能的代码提示和代码编辑,让工程师更方便和更快捷地开发Egret项目。
 
5. 强大的Debug功能。在TypeScript的代码中设置断点,开启调试模式,支持断点、单步和连续单步执行方式。支持查看表达式和变量,可进行逐步调试。

  3、ResDepot:资源管理工具

ResDepot是一款可视化资源管理工具。它能轻松高效地管理海量游戏素材和配置文件资源,帮你快速生成Egret游戏中所需的资源配置文件,轻松定制灵活的分组加载规则。通过可视化的拖曳操作,快速完成资源配置文件。

4、Texture Merger:资源打包工具

Texture Merger是一款纹理集打包和动画转换工具,如图3-13所示是其界面。主要提供了3个游戏开发常用功能。

  • 精灵表输出。Texture Merger可将零散的小图合并为大图纹理集,提高资源加载速度和游戏性能。在游戏研发过程中,开发者可使用小图开发,在产品发布时对资源进行合并,无须修改代码。
  • MovieClip动画转换。Texture Merger可方便地将GIF或SWF动画转换为Egret支持的动画格式。
  • 位图字体。为高品质游戏的个性文字效果输出提供了方便快捷的解决方案。
posted @   小那  阅读(963)  评论(0编辑  收藏  举报
编辑推荐:
· AI与.NET技术实操系列:基于图像分类模型对图像进行分类
· go语言实现终端里的倒计时
· 如何编写易于单元测试的代码
· 10年+ .NET Coder 心语,封装的思维:从隐藏、稳定开始理解其本质意义
· .NET Core 中如何实现缓存的预热?
阅读排行:
· 25岁的心里话
· 闲置电脑爆改个人服务器(超详细) #公网映射 #Vmware虚拟网络编辑器
· 零经验选手,Compose 一天开发一款小游戏!
· 通过 API 将Deepseek响应流式内容输出到前端
· AI Agent开发,如何调用三方的API Function,是通过提示词来发起调用的吗
点击右上角即可分享
微信分享提示